JEOL High Sensitivity GC-TOF Increases Data Acquisition Speed and Mass Resolving Power

August 3, 2012 (Peabody, Mass.) – JEOL’s newest AccuTOF GCv model – the “4G” – now offers even faster data acquisition rates and higher resolving power than its predecessor. The AccuTOF-GCv|4G has a maximum data acquisition rate of 50 spectra per second and a resolving power of 8000. The 50 Hz acquisition rate now makes... Read more

JEOL Introduces Highest Sensitivity GC-TOF Mass Spectrometer

Peabody, Mass., March 6, 2009 — The new AccuTOF-GCv from JEOL features the highest sensitivity of any GC time-of-flight mass spectrometer commercially available. By combining rapid data acquisition speeds with high resolution and a high dynamic range, the AccuTOF-GCv delivers exact mass measurements for both qualitative and quantitative analysis.
